## Local Setup – Shoalmark Tide Widget

Clone the repo. Install deps with the bundled script. Seed data covers two invented harbours; enough for most support repros. Run the dev server on the default port. If tide rows look empty, the seed step failed — re-run it, don't patch by hand. Widget reads only; writes come from the ingest job. Connect to the local seed database with the string below.

replica DSN, kajep-yahag: mssql://praok_svc:iF@db-8d68.plorvaio.local:5432/eliion

## RateSentry Parity Checker — Restart Procedure

RateSentry polls partner booking sites for the Hollowmere Hotels group every fifteen minutes and flags rooms whose advertised rates diverge from the master tariff. If the worker stalls, drain the queue before restarting; otherwise stale comparisons get flagged as violations and the revenue team at Hollowmere gets paged for nothing. After a restart, verify the poller picks up all three partner feeds. The values below reflect the current production configuration.

settings of fafog-haduf:
ZORIX_PIN=4648
ZORIX_METRICS_HOST=metrics.zorix.paliqsys.corp
ZORIX_LOG_LEVEL=info
ZORIX_TENANT=druix

**Vendor note: Inkmill markdown pipeline**

Rendering for Parchway docs is outsourced to Inkmill under an annual contract, renewing each March. They handle sanitization and PDF export; we own the upload queue. SLA: 4-hour response on rendering failures. Escalate only after two failed retries. Their support desk is reachable at the address below.

billing contact of hahaf-baguf = zorael.tammir.jorius@sivrelhq.internal

Heads up for the sync: Snackline's restock planner used to guess refill routes from yesterday's sales, which broke badly around holidays. The new version on the Coilworth scheduler pulls a rolling two-week window instead and plans per-machine rather than per-route. Migration is mostly painless — export the old route table, run the converter, and let the planner rebuild its cache overnight. One gotcha: the converter won't run until the planner is started with the configuration shown below.

service settings:
[pelius]
port = 5432
team = praius
host = pelius.crelvoforge.internal
region = upper-4
access_code = ac_8f224d
timeout_ms = 2000